Transaction 324a39ab12920f31f17f547316cf9d799477a8c00018107795fcdb83f6618dc9
1 Input
1 Output
-
324a39ab12920f31f17f547316cf9d799477a8c00018107795fcdb83f6618dc9:0
- value
- 302483
- script pubkey
- OP_0 OP_PUSHBYTES_32 56cae1a71862ed60fba8015a01d5690a1904424f820d35797b869d69071c209b
- address
- bc1q2m9wrfccvtkkp7agq9dqr4tfpgvsgsj0sgxn27tms6wkjpcuyzdsfm4nvl